Rudy Gobert could return to the Utah Jazz lineup for Monday's game against the Wizards.

“Well, I defer to our medical group on that,” said Quin Snyder. “We’re going to confer and trust those guys to not do anything to put Rudy in harm’s way and when he’s ready to go he’ll be ready to go.”

Gobert has missed Utah's past 11 games with a bone bruise in his right knee.

Gobert was initially expected to miss at least four weeks but it has been just over three weeks since his injury.

Derrick Favors has played well at center with Gobert out.
